EvoCal

These tests are to test the calendar functionality of the Evolution package. Please try to run all of the following tests. All tests require being in Calendars view.

Report any bugs you find using the following command in a terminal:

ubuntu-bug evolution

You can learn more about reporting bugs at http://wiki.ubuntu.com/ReportingBugs.

Tests

New Appointments

  1. Click the New button
  2. Fill in the summary, date, and time fields
  3. Click Save
  4. Verify that the appointment shows up in the Month, Day, and Week views (Work Week as well if it's a workday). On the Day view it should span the proper times

Appointment Recurrence: forever

  1. Create an appointment
  2. Click the Recurrence button on the toolbar of the appointment-adding window
  3. Check the "This appointment recurs" checkbox
  4. Choose a frequency and the "forever" option
  5. Close the Recurrence window and Save the appointment
  6. Choose a month far in the future (say, 10 years?) and verify that the appointment is still repeating

Appointment Recurrence: modification

  1. Open the appointment that is supposed to recur forever and go to its Recurrence window
  2. Change from "forever" to "until" and choose a date
  3. Verify that the appointment stops recurring after that date

Appointment Recurrence: exceptions

  1. Open an appointment that has recurrence and go to its Recurrence window
  2. Next to the Exceptions box, click the Add button
  3. Choose a date on which it would recur and click OK
  4. Close the Recurrence window and Save the appointment
  5. Verify that the appointment does not show up on that date in any calendar view

Appointment Recurrence: days of the week

  1. Create a new appointment and go to its Recurrence window
  2. Choose to repeat weekly
  3. You should be presented with the days of the week. Choose a few
  4. Close the Recurrence window and Save the appointment
  5. Verify that the appointment shows up on those days of the week


Parent page: ApplicationTesting

CategoryAppTesting

Testing/Applications/EvoCal (last edited 2009-06-15 20:04:54 by c-24-21-50-133)